Are you a passionate psychology/sociology teacher looking for an exciting opportunity in a vibrant school community? We are seeking a dedicated psychology/sociology teacher to join a well-established school in Brackley on a temporary basis from April 23rd to June 30th. The successful candidate will teach psychology and sociology across KS4 and KS5, with some PSHCE lessons included.
School Information
The school’s Humanities and Social Sciences department is a dynamic and forward-thinking team that prides itself on delivering engaging and thought-provoking psychology and sociology lessons. The department offers strong support to staff, ensuring teachers have access to comprehensive resources and effective mentoring. With a curriculum designed to foster critical thinking and student engagement, the successful psychology/sociology teacher will join a dedicated team committed to student success.
Experience and Qualifications
Salary
The salary for this psychology/sociology teacher position will be paid to scale on a temporary contract (MPS/UPS).
